Ralph Modin
Aug. 13, 1948 - Nov. 24, 2018
Ralph Luther Modin Jr.,
70, of Kenmare, ND,
passed away on No-
vember 24, 2018 in Ken-
mare. Ralph was born in
Minot on August 13,
1948, the son of Ralph
and Ella (Watland) Modin.
He was raised on the fam-
ily farm in Kenmare.
Ralph attended Spencer
Township country school
and graduated from Ken-
mare High School in
1966. He attended Oak
Hills Bible College and
NDSCS Wahpeton where
he received his certifica-
tion in automotive
mechanics. Ralph joined
the Army Reserve in 1969.
Ralph served in the Army
Reserve as a combat med-
ic for six years. He spent
many hours caring for
wounded Soldiers from
the Vietnam War. He was
honored to have had the
opportunity to serve his
country.
Ralph was united in
marriage to Sandra Daae
of Estevan, Saskatchewan
on December 18, 1971.
They lived on the family
farm southwest of Ken-
mare where they raised
their three children Lyn-
don, Shana, and Brenna.
Ralph spent countless
hours working on the
farm, custom spraying,
helping neighbors, owner
of Lakeside Performance,
Oilfield work, and engag-
ing in many of his count-
less hobbies: driving the
#24 at Nodak Speedway,
flying planes, racing
snowmobiles from Regina
to Minot or working in his
shop. He loved his grand-
children and spent time
playing bull, fixing up
four-wheelers for them to
ride at the farm, or at-
tending their activities.
They always knew Grand-
pa Ralph was there when
they heard the “cowbell.”
He had a passion for help-
ing people no matter how
much or little they had.
He was our rock and hero.
